This game truly shines in it's multiplayer:
Multiplayer is a bast with all the different characters, special abilities, and weapons. It truly feels like a Quake 3 or Unreal Tournament shooter arcade game. The different character weakness's and weapon modes add a whole lot of strategy to multiplayer games. The weapon modes are: Heat, Cold, Energy, and Impact... which almost each character has a certain weakness to and also resistance to. So if lets say, the character Magmor is weak to Cold, then he is resistant to Heat. Each weapon has 2 modes, heat and cold, or energy and impact. There are 5 multiplayer modes including CTF, Skirmish (Deathmatch), Team Skirmish, Avatar (where you use your avatars head and kill your buddies avatars), and Invasion Mode.
Invasion mode is something unique and special. In this mode, you and the enemy build your side of a map simultaneously. After it is built, you choose nodes and choose a spot for the base. When building is complete, both sides are put together and then you get a glimpse of what your enemy build. Invasion adds a whole new level of strategy because your can add long narrow corridoors or pinch points into your maps.
